>Wagering Requirements: The Fine Print

Wagering requirements are where many bonuses fall flat. A 40x wagering rule means you must bet the bonus amount 40 times before you can withdraw any winnings. This can turn a £100 bonus into a £4,000 obligation. The numbers vary: 32Red, Coral, and William Hill sit at a more manageable 30x. 888 Casino is at 35x. The majority, including MrQ, Sky Vegas, Mecca Bingo, PlayOJO, and Sun Vegas, stick to 38x. Party Casino is the highest at 40x. Always check the T&Cs before claiming any offer.

KYC Checks: Necessary but a Bit of a Pain

Know Your Customer (KYC) checks are a legal requirement for all UKGC-licensed casinos. They’re designed to prevent money laundering and underage gambling. However, they can be a hassle for players who just want to get on with their quick bet. Most operators require proof of ID (passport or driving licence) and proof of address (a recent utility bill or bank statement).

The speed of KYC verification varies. Some casinos, like MrQ and PlayOJO, have streamlined the process and can verify documents in under an hour. Others can take up to 48 hours, especially if you submit documents on a weekend or bank holiday. Our advice is to get KYC done as soon as you register, before you even make a deposit. This way, when you hit a big win, the withdrawal process is instant.

>What to Do If a Withdrawal Is Delayed

If your withdrawal has not arrived within the stated timeframe, the first step is to check your casino account for any pending KYC documents. Many delays are caused by incomplete verification. If everything is in order, contact customer support via live chat. They can usually see the status of your withdrawal and escalate it if necessary. If you’re still not satisfied, you can escalate the dispute to IBAS (ibas-uk.com), which is the independent betting and gaming adjudication service for the UK.

>What is a wagering requirement?

A wagering requirement is the number of times you must bet a bonus before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a 40x wagering requirement on a £100 bonus means you must bet £4,000 before cashing out. Always choose bonuses with lower wagering requirements, such as 30x or 35x.
